Sixth Grand Concert, Masonic Hall, September 17th, at 8 p.m. Artists: Miss Dorothy Penfold, A.R.C.M., Miss Myrtle Knight, Mr J Danks, Mr Arthur E Sayer, Mr H Williams. Conductor: Mr W C Frazier, A.R.C.O., Pianist: Miss Muriel Hyett, L.A.B. Admission 1?- and 1d. Tax. Patron: His Worship the Mayor, Cr Ambrose Dunstan. Office Bearers: President-Mr H M Leggo. Vice Presidents-Mr M G Giudice & Cr J H Curnow. Sub-Conductor-Mr E A Miller. Treasurer & Librarian-Mr W H Dolphin. Assistant Librarian-Mr R J G Duguid. Assistant Secretary-Mr F A Wittscheibe. Committee-Office Bearers, with Mesdames Perry & Scott, Misses Colgan, Veale, Gall and Weeks, and Messrs. Duguid, Sleeman, W Brown, F Wittsheibe and F J Walter. Hon. Secretary-J Huspeth, 85 Wills Street, Bendigo.
